India is likely to experience below-normal rainfall in September, with the India Meteorological Department (IMD) on Monday (August 31, 2026) forecasting rainfall across the country to be at least 9% short of the long-period average of 167.9 mm. This comes after India experienced the hottest August since 1901.

September brings in about a fifth of the June-September monsoon rain, less than July’s 32% and August’s 29%. As of August 31, India’s cumulative monsoon rainfall was about 14% below normal, with central India in surplus but the northwest, east and northeast, and south peninsula all recording deficits. India received 213.3 mm of rain in August, the seventh-lowest since 2001. The country’s mean temperature reached 28.01°C, or about 0.67°C above normal. The average minimum temperature, at 24.36°C, was also the highest on record. Four low-pressure systems, precursors to cyclonic storms and, in the Indian context, mostly originating in the Bay of Bengal, persisted for a combined 26 days in August. This is substantially longer than the climatological average of 16.3 low-pressure days.

IMD’s outlook at a press briefing comes on the back of a dry August. IMD Director-General Mrutyunjay Mohapatra explained this as a consequence of the ongoing El Niño, which dries out the atmosphere and raises temperatures. However, the month was not uniformly dry, with repeated low-pressure systems bringing heavy rain across the Indo-Gangetic Plains and parts of central and eastern India. For September, the IMD expects above-normal maximum temperatures over most of India and above-normal minimum temperatures over most areas, adding to the prospect of a warm, relatively dry end to the monsoon. However, their rainfall activity was largely confined to the Indo-Gangetic Plain. The systems repeatedly formed over the Bay of Bengal, moved west-northwest, and weakened over central and northern India. Frequent Western Disturbances – extra-tropical storms originating in the Mediterranean – also interacted with the monsoon circulation and low-pressure or cyclonic circulations, helping concentrate intense rainfall over eastern, east-central and parts of northwestern India rather than producing a more widespread monsoon revival.

Many parts of the country are expected to remain drier than normal, although parts of northwest, northeast, east, east-central India and isolated areas of southeast peninsular India could receive “normal to above-normal rainfall”.
